Like all things, there's always a point of diminishing return. Nevertheless, I have noticed that smeo guys do light up their bikes like a Christmas tree.
In my experience three should be the limit, and provides the best compromise between utility and safety. I have two strobes permanently mounted to my bike and affix an additional (high-mount) blinking red light to my helmet.
This combination can be seen by anyone from as far as a mile away. Its attention grabbing without being distracting. My headlight has only died once on me -- because I forgot to recharge it -- but I still need a backup (I have two flashlights but no mounts) just for those types of instances.
